What is an Anti-Hail Net System?
An Anti-Hail Net System is an agricultural protection structure designed to protect crops from hailstorms and extreme weather conditions.
The system mainly consists of:
- Prestressed concrete posts
- Anti-hail nets
- Galvanized steel wires
- Steel strands
- Binding wires
- Wire tensioners
- Fixing accessories
Through professional structural design and tensioning systems, the anti-hail net creates a stable protective layer to reduce hail impact on crops.
Compared with traditional enclosed greenhouses, anti-hail net systems provide lower investment costs, better ventilation, easier maintenance, and are suitable for large-scale orchard and outdoor farming projects.
Main Components of Anti-Hail Net System

1. Prestressed Concrete Post Structure
The Anti-Hail Net System uses high-strength prestressed concrete posts as the main supporting structure.
Prestressed concrete posts are reinforced with prestressed steel wires inside the concrete, providing excellent compressive strength, crack resistance, and long-term stability for outdoor agricultural applications.
Compared with ordinary concrete posts, prestressed concrete posts offer:
- Higher strength
- Better stability
- Strong wind resistance
- Longer service life
- Lower maintenance requirements
Different specifications can be customized according to local climate conditions, wind speed requirements, and project size, including:
- Post height
- Post dimensions
- Concrete strength grade
- Reinforcement configuration
- Foundation depth

2. High-strength Anti-Hail Net
The anti-hail net is the key protective material of the system.
Usually manufactured from high-density polyethylene (HDPE), it provides excellent tensile strength and weather resistance.
The net absorbs and distributes hail impact force, effectively protecting crops from damage.
Main features:
- High tensile strength
- UV resistance
- Long service life
- Lightweight
- Good light transmission
- Excellent weather resistance
Different specifications can be selected according to hail intensity, climate conditions, and crop requirements.

3. Steel Wire and Steel Strand Support System
To maintain stable tension of the anti-hail net, the system uses a professional wire support structure, including:
- Galvanized steel wire
- Steel strand
- Binding wire
- Edge fixing wire
- Cross support wire
The wire and steel strand system connects the concrete posts together, improving structural stability and wind resistance.


4. Tensioning and Fixing System
To maintain proper tension and stability, the system includes:
- Wire tensioners
- Wire clamps
- Fixing clips
- Connectors
- Ground anchors
- Bolts and accessories
The tensioning system allows adjustment of wire tension, keeping the anti-hail net flat and stable during long-term operation.

Advantages of Anti-Hail Net System
Effective Hail Protection
The anti-hail net reduces hail impact energy and prevents direct damage to fruits, vegetables, and nursery plants.
Excellent Natural Ventilation
The open structure allows continuous airflow and helps control temperature and humidity.
Lower Investment Cost
Compared with glass and plastic film greenhouses, anti-hail net systems require lower investment and are ideal for large-scale agricultural projects.
Improved Crop Quality
The system reduces physical damage caused by hail and improves fruit appearance and market value.
Long Service Life
The combination of prestressed concrete posts, durable anti-hail nets, and high-quality wire systems provides reliable outdoor performance.
